My-MeloDS (read: my melodies) is a piano-based music application for the purpose of ear training and basic composition. There are 4 modes: Free Mode, Ear Training Mode, Composition and Metronome.

User guide

Free Mode - This mode allows free play on the piano with no restrictions.

Ear Training Mode - Follow the instructions on the top screen to determine how to complete each test. Tests are scored right or wrong and have clear cut answers.

Compostion Mode - Able to create a simple melody using the notes provided. It prevents a note overrun (tied notes), so you cannot place a note duration that does not fit a perfect measure in 4/4 time.

Known issues

Text shows up strangely on slot 2 cards.
